Abi Dhar al-Ghafari Healthcare Center obtains ISO 9001:2015 certification

Damascus, SANA- Abi Dhar al-Ghafari Health Care Center in Damascus received ISO 9001:2015 certification related to the development of medical work and the provision of high quality services.

The center, which is located in Mazzeh area,Damascus, provides medical services to more than 2,800 families registered with it, including vaccination, radiography, and laboratory tests, as well as other services through clinics for examining newborns and children, reproductive and maternal health, family medicine, dentistry, diabetes, ophthalmology, dermatology and psychiatry.

While handing over the certificate to the center’s management Thursday, Minister of Health, Hassan al-Ghobash, stressed in a statement to SANA reporter the importance of the certificate because it is an international quality certificate granted after applying and meeting the required international standards, which constitutes a greater motivation to continue the work.

‘Despite the effects of the terrorist war and the economic siege on Syria, the health cadres are making every effort to provide the best medical services to citizens.” al-Ghobash added.

The Director of Damascus Health, Muhammad Samer Shahrour, indicated that the Center is the first health one in Syria to obtain this certificate, and it has a lot of importance in terms of encouraging the provision of quality services to patients and supporting the efforts of medical staff.

For her part,  Head of the Center, Hazar Miqdad, saw that obtaining such certificate pushes the cadres to do more and more to continue providing services with the best quality, pointing out that the center provides free services to more than 2500 patients per month.

It is noteworthy that the number of diagnostic and treatment services provided by the center during the current year reached 31,000 services for more than 21,000 patients.
